Policy 8.10 Notice of Proposed Rule

Post Date:10/22/2025 12:00 PM
NOTICE OF PROPOSED RULE
SCHOOL BOARD OF SARASOTA COUNTY, FLORIDA
RULE NO.: 8.10 RULE TITLE: Safety
PURPOSE AND EFFECT: To modify the existing policy and to update procedures relating to school safety and reporting of SESIR incidents.
SUMMARY: These revisions remove align the reporting requirements for certain incidents with the appropriate Administrative Rule, rather than a fixed number..
SUMMARY OF STATEMENT OF ESTIMATED REGULATORY COSTS AND LEGISLATIVE RATIFICATION:
The School Board has determined that this rule will not have an adverse impact on small business or likely increase directly or indirectly regulatory costs in excess of $200,000 in the aggregate within one year after the implementation of the rule. A SERC has not been prepared by the agency.
The Agency has determined that the proposed rule is not expected to require legislative ratification based on the statement of estimated regulatory costs or if no SERC is required, the information expressly relied upon and described herein: No SERC is required at this time by FS 120.54 or FS 120.541. In the event a SERC becomes required, the School Board of Sarasota County, Florida will promptly prepare one.
Any person who wishes to provide information regarding the statement of estimated regulatory costs, or to provide a proposal for a lower cost regulatory alternative must do so in writing within 21 days of this notice.
RULEMAKING AUTHORITY: 1001.41(2), 1001.43(4), Fla. Stat.
LAW IMPLEMENTED: Sections 773.06, 790.06, 790.115, 1001.43, 1006.062(3), 1006.07, F.S.
IF REQUESTED WITHIN 21 DAYS OF THE DATE OF THIS NOTICE, A HEARING WILL BE SCHEDULED AND ANNOUNCED IN CONFORMANCE WITH FS 120.54(3) AND 120.81(1)(d).
THE PERSON TO BE CONTACTED REGARDING THE PROPOSED RULE IS: Chris Parenteau, Supervisor, Government Affairs, Sarasota County Schools. 1960 Landings Blvd, Sarasota, FL, 34231. 941.927.9000
THE FULL TEXT OF THE PROPOSED RULE IS:

 
I. The supervisor of each site or facility shall establish a school safety team which shall be responsible to identify, prevent and mitigate issues that pertain to safety, security, and emergency management issues and to advance the promotion of safety education and accident prevention program for that site. Committees shall meet a minimum of four times per year, preferably once per grading period.

II. Schools shall cooperate with the Law Enforcement Agencies, First Responders, and other agencies promoting safety education.

III. To assist in carrying out the responsibilities for safety, each principal shall appoint a member of the staff as school safety team coordinator.

IV. No person shall bring on any School Board premises or have in his/her possession or in his/her vehicle on any School Board property, any firearm, weapon or destructive device unless such weapon is required as part of his/her regular job responsibilities and authorized by Florida Statute and School Board Policy or except when permitted by law.

V. School Environmental Safety Incident Reporting. The Superintendent shall develop and implement procedures for timely and accurate reporting of incidents related to school safety and discipline and shall provide training to appropriate personnel in accordance with law and State Board of Education rules. The District will utilize Florida’s School Environmental Safety Incident Reporting (SESIR) Statewide Report on School Safety and Discipline Data to report the incidents of crime, violence and disruptive behaviors that occur on school grounds, on school transportation, and at off-campus, school sponsored events to the Department Of Education in accordance with Rule 6A-1.0017 F.A.C.

A. The Superintendent will annually report to the Department of Education the number of involuntary examinations, as defined in section 394.455, F.S., that were initiated at a school, on school transportation, or at a school- sponsored activity.
B. The Superintendent must certify to the Department of Education that the requirements for timely and accurate reporting of SESIR incidents has been met.
C. School principals must ensure that all persons at the school level responsible for documenting SESIR information participate in the on-line training offered by the Department and ensure that SESIR data is accurately and timely reported.

VI. A child under the age of sixteen (16) shall wear appropriate headgear as required by law for any equine activity on a public school site. Students shall wear appropriate headgear when participating in an off campus, school sponsored equine activity as required by law.
VII. The Superintendent or designee shall require that hazardous conditions found on any School Board property be reported immediately and that reported hazards be investigated and corrected or removed, as appropriate.
VIII. School alarm systems shall be monitored on a monthly basis or more frequently as needed. Any malfunction shall be reported for immediate repair.

IX. The Superintendent shall develop appropriate emergency management and emergency preparedness plans.

X. The School Board delegates to the Chief of the Sarasota County Schools Police (SCSPD) Department the authority to develop and implement appropriate General Orders relating to the administration of the SCSPD. These General Orders must comply with State law and may not be inconsistent with the provisions of any School Board Policy or collective bargaining agreement(s) between the School Board and any bargaining unit representing members of the SCSPD.

XI. With the approval of the School Board, the Superintendent is authorized to install metal detectors and other security devices which would assist in the detection of guns and dangerous weapons in school buildings and/or on District property.
